What is calorimetry in chemistry?
One technique we can use to measure the amount of heat involved in a chemical or physical process is known as calorimetry. Calorimetry is used to measure amounts of heat transferred to or from a substance. To do so, the heat is exchanged with a calibrated object (calorimeter).
What is calorimetry in physics definition?
Calorimetry is the science associated with determining the changes in energy of a system by measuring the heat exchanged with the surroundings. A calorimeter is a device used to measure the quantity of heat transferred to or from an object.
What is calorimetry and how does it work?
Calorimetry is used to measure amounts of heat transferred to or from a substance. To do so, the heat is exchanged with a calibrated object (calorimeter). The temperature change measured by the calorimeter is used to derive the amount of heat transferred by the process under study.

What is the aim of calorimetry?
The purpose of making calorimetric measurements on minerals and other substances is to obtain enthalpy information. The enthalpy values that are measured relate to the bond strengths in a substance and constitute one of several types of energy used to determine the stability conditions of geologic materials.
Why calorimeter is called calorimeter?
In 1780, Antoine Lavoisier used the heat from the guinea pig’s respiration to melt snow surrounding his apparatus, showing that respiratory gas exchange is combustion, similar to a candle burning. Lavoisier dubbed this apparatus the calorimeter, based on both Greek and Latin roots.

What are calorimetric techniques?
Calorimetry is a primary technique for measuring the thermal properties of materials to establish a connection between temperature and specific physical properties of substances and is the only method for direct determination of the enthalpy associated with the process of interest.
What is the principle of method of mixtures?
The principle of the method of mixtures tells us that the heat lost by a hot body is equal to the heat gained by the cold body when they are mixed together and attain the equilibrium condition or the same temperature. This principle is based on the law of conservation of energy.

What type of reaction is used in calorimetry?
The majority of reactions that can be analyzed in a calorimetry experiment are either liquids or aqueous solutions .
